Frequently Asked Questions about Ford Bronco in Woodstock, GA

What engine comes standard in the new Ford Bronco?

The new Ford Bronco is equipped with a 2.3L EcoBoost I-4 engine. This powertrain is designed to provide responsive performance for both highway merging and off-road driving.

Does the Ford Bronco offer a manual transmission?

Yes, the Ford Bronco features a 7-Speed Manual transmission that includes a specialized granny gear and a crank in gear function, plus Hill Descent Control for better handling on steep terrain.

How does the Ford Bronco handle cargo and seating?

The interior features a 50-50 folding split-bench rear seat that allows you to configure your cargo space as needed. The vehicle also includes swing-out rear cargo access to make loading your gear easier.

What safety features are included in the Ford Bronco?

The Bronco comes with AdvanceTrac with Roll Stability Control, electronic stability control, and side impact beams. It also includes Ford Co-Pilot360 features like auto high-beam headlamps for increased visibility.

Comparing Bronco Performance and Capability

When you compare the Bronco to other models like the Bronco Sport or the Ford Explorer, you will notice differences in powertrain and ride character. While the Bronco Sport offers an 8-speed automatic and a focus on daily efficiency, the Bronco is geared toward a more rugged, traditional SUV experience.

The mechanical setup of the Bronco, including its electronic transfer case and part-time four-wheel drive, is built to handle more challenging terrain than a typical crossover. Understanding these differences helps you decide if you need the heavy-duty capability of the Bronco or the refined, daily-commuter focus of a model like the Escape.

  • The 2.3L EcoBoost engine is tuned for a balance of power and efficiency, suitable for both highway cruising and off-road capability.
  • Hill Descent Control provides extra confidence when navigating steep inclines, keeping your speed consistent without constant braking.
  • The swing-out rear cargo access makes it easier to load items in tight parking spots near local venues or shopping centers.
